No. 'Peter Pan' is not a gay novel. 'Peter Pan' is mainly a story about a boy who never grows up, his adventures in Neverland with the Lost Boys, Tinker Bell, and his encounters with pirates like Captain Hook. It focuses on themes of childhood, imagination, and the longing for eternal youth rather than any gay themes.
One reason is that J.K. Rowling herself revealed that Dumbledore was gay. This opened the door for fans to explore this aspect of his character more deeply in fanfiction. It allows fans to fill in the gaps in the story that the original books didn't fully explore regarding his love life.
